Compartilhar via


Método IXpsOMDashCollection::RemoveAt (xpsobjectmodel.h)

Remove e libera uma estrutura XPS_DASH de um local especificado na coleção.

Sintaxe

HRESULT RemoveAt(
  [in] UINT32 index
);

Parâmetros

[in] index

O índice baseado em zero na coleção da qual uma estrutura XPS_DASH deve ser removida e liberada.

Retornar valor

Se o método for bem-sucedido, ele retornará S_OK; caso contrário, ele retornará um código de erro HRESULT .

Comentários

Esse método remove e libera a estrutura de XPS_DASH referenciada pelo ponteiro no local especificado pelo índice. Depois de liberar a estrutura, esse método compacta a coleção reduzindo em 1 o índice de cada ponteiro subsequente ao índice.

A figura a seguir ilustra como a coleção é alterada pelo método RemoveAt .

Uma figura que mostra como RemoveAt remove uma entrada da coleção dash

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 7, Windows Vista com SP2 e Atualização de Plataforma para Windows Vista [aplicativos da área de trabalho | Aplicativos UWP]
Servidor mínimo com suporte Windows Server 2008 R2, Windows Server 2008 com SP2 e Platform Update para Windows Server 2008 [aplicativos da área de trabalho | Aplicativos UWP]
Plataforma de Destino Windows
Cabeçalho xpsobjectmodel.h

Confira também

IXpsOMDashCollection

Especificação de Papel XML

XPS_DASH